Transaction 0863c74641205b3ba3e56282bfa7bec0d41f9fa5d0eeb35119706f8cc4f815c0

1 Input
2 Outputs
  • 0863c74641205b3ba3e56282bfa7bec0d41f9fa5d0eeb35119706f8cc4f815c0:0
  • value  10248240
    address  3HwbcedwVi4xW7utkrYQY7MGa7p9YM63UX
  • 0863c74641205b3ba3e56282bfa7bec0d41f9fa5d0eeb35119706f8cc4f815c0:1
  • value  67447578
    address  1KK5FuzCfd4MVjsYf6WgjGkm5FyR6uepLW